以前、紹介したExcelのシートコピー時のエラー回避でも
「名前の重複」が消えないことが分かり、
その消し方を紹介致します。
Excelの画面で「Alt」+「F11」を同時にキーボードを押します。
下記の画面が表示されます。
「Alt」+「I」+「M」を同時にキーボードを押します。
すると下記の画面が表示されます。
ここに以下を入力します。
Public Sub VisibleNames()
Dim name As Object
For Each name In Names
If name.Visible = False Then
name.Visible = True
End If
Next
MsgBox "すべての名前の定義を表示しました。", vbOKOnly
End Sub
Excelの画面に戻り
「表示」、「マクロ4の表示」をクリックします。
「VisibleNames」をクリックし、「実行」をクリックすます。
あとは、「数式」、「名前の管理」をクリックすると
隠れていた無名の名前が表示されますので、選択して、削除すれば、
終わりです。
意外に簡単ですね。
Y.I
0 件のコメント:
コメントを投稿